What You'll Do
As a Registered Dietitian, you will assess residents' nutritional needs and provide the documentation, education, and care planning support needed to meet state, federal, and Hillcrest standards.
You will:
- Assess residents and develop individualized nutrition plans of care.
- Ensure residents' nutritional needs are met in alignment with care goals, physician orders, and regulatory requirements.
- Review labs, MAR/TAR, weights, diet orders, and clinical changes to identify needed interventions.
- Monitor and help prevent significant weight loss.
- Complete required clinical documentation accurately and timely.
- Complete Section K of the MDS and stay current with clinical documentation needs.
- Attend NAR meetings and collaborate with interdisciplinary team members.
- Provide nutrition education to residents, families, and team members as needed.
- Develop and support nutritional in-services to help ensure appropriate dietary information is understood and followed.
- Calculate, order, and monitor tube feeding needs.
- Monitor residents who require assisted dining support.
- Partner with Culinary Services leadership on menu recommendations and resident nutrition needs.
- Demonstrate knowledge of state and federal regulations for skilled nursing, post-acute, and long-term care settings.
- Build positive, professional relationships with residents, families, team members, and leadership.
